Not forgetting the four seasons of Hanoi ^.^ simply love Hanoi during January... Wake up at 6am in the morning... Walk to one of the small alleys next to my hotel, wearing a wind breaker.. sit down at a small table next to an old wall with traces of algae and call out to the old auntie, standing behind the pho stall a couple of tables away...
As she acknowledges your order..Her hands are working non-stop while she bracing the cold morning weather making my order of a hot bowl of Pho Bo...
As she brings my pho... The cold air kinda condenses the aroma and immediately shot up to my brain, giving me a "CHAO BUOI SANG!"
Next, I dip the metal spoon into the hot soup and took a sip...
"Ahhhhhhh....", Followed quickly with a slurp of Pho....
Heavenly....
